#65799c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#65799c is composed of 39.6% red, 47.5%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.3% cyan, 22.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 218.2 degrees, a saturation of 21.7% and a lightness of 50.4%. #65799c color hex could be obtained by blending #caf2ff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#65799c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#65799c has RGB values of R:101, G:121,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 6650268.
